Sunroom window replacement services involve removing existing windows in a sunroom and installing new, energy-efficient models. This process typically includes careful measurement, removal of the old windows, and precise installation of the new units to ensure a secure fit. The goal is to enhance the sunroom’s appearance, improve insulation, and increase energy savings, making the space more comfortable year-round. Homeowners interested in upgrading their sunroom windows often seek out experienced contractors who can handle the specific demands of working with existing structures and provide options that match the home's style.

This service helps address common issues such as drafty windows, difficulty opening or closing, and visible signs of damage like cracks or warping. Over time, sunroom windows can become less effective at insulating, leading to higher heating and cooling costs. Replacing worn or outdated windows can also improve the overall safety and security of the sunroom, reducing the risk of break-ins or accidents caused by broken glass. For homeowners noticing increased noise from outside or experiencing difficulty maintaining a consistent indoor temperature, window replacement can offer a practical solution.

The overview below groups typical Sunroom Window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Southbury, CT.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or sunroom window replacements in Southbury range from $250 to $600 per window. Many routine repairs fall within this middle range, depending on window size and type. Fewer projects will push into the higher tiers for more extensive work.

Standard Full Replacement - Replacing all windows in a standard-sized sunroom usually costs between $3,000 and $8,000. Local contractors often see many projects in this range, with larger or custom jobs reaching higher prices.

Complex or Custom Projects - Larger, more complex sunroom window replacements can cost $10,000 or more. These projects typically involve custom designs, specialty materials, or structural modifications, which can significantly increase costs.

Material and Frame Choices - Costs vary based on window materials like vinyl, aluminum, or wood, with prices generally ranging from $200 to $1,200 per window. The choice of frame and glass options influences the overall expense, with premium materials pushing prices higher.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

When evaluating contractors for sunroom window replacement, it’s important to consider their experience with similar projects in Southbury and surrounding areas. A contractor who has successfully completed comparable installations will better understand local building conditions and potential challenges, helping to ensure the job is done properly. Homeowners should inquire about the contractor’s background with projects of similar scope and complexity, as this can provide insight into their familiarity with the specific requirements involved in sunroom window upgrades.

Clear, written expectations are essential to a smooth project. Homeowners should seek service providers who can provide detailed proposals outlining the scope of work, materials to be used, and any relevant specifications. Having these details in writing helps prevent misunderstandings and ensures that both parties are aligned on the project’s goals. It’s also advisable to ask for reputable references from previous clients who have had similar work completed, as this can offer a firsthand perspective on the contractor’s reliability, quality of work, and professionalism.

Effective communication is a key factor in selecting the right service provider. Homeowners should look for contractors who are responsive, transparent, and willing to answer questions throughout the process. Good communication fosters trust and allows for any concerns or adjustments to be addressed promptly.
